(Oven mitts decorated with fish or cats... WebAccording to the FDA Food Code, hair restraints like hair nets, baseball caps, or hats are acceptable to wear. The main goal is to use a hair covering that will hold any dislodged hair in place so it doesn’t fall into food or onto equipment. Hair restraints also help keep you from touching your hair and contaminating your hands.
